Fuzzy Stick Flowers
Create cheerful flowers in under 15 minutes. This project is suitable for all skill levels, requiring minimal materials and time.
- Cut several fuzzy sticks into varying lengths to represent petals.
- Twist the cut pieces together at their bases to form a flower shape.
- Use a green fuzzy stick to create the stem and leaves.
- Twist the stem to the base of the flower.
- Add additional leaves as desired.
Fuzzy Stick Caterpillars
Construct adorable caterpillars in approximately 20 minutes. This project is perfect for younger crafters.
- Gather several fuzzy sticks of various colors.
- Attach the fuzzy sticks end-to-end, slightly overlapping each segment.
- Twist the ends together securely to create the caterpillar’s body.
- Use small googly eyes and pipe cleaner antennae to add features.
- Optional: Add legs using smaller pieces of fuzzy sticks.
Fuzzy Stick Spiders
Design spooky spiders in around 15-20 minutes. A great Halloween craft!
- Use black fuzzy sticks for the spider’s body and legs.
- Form a small circle for the body using a single stick.
- Attach eight legs of varying lengths to the body using twisting.
- Add googly eyes to complete the spider.
- Optional: Add a small piece of red fuzzy stick to mimic a mouth.
Fuzzy Stick Stars
Make shimmering stars in approximately 10 minutes. This is a simple project ideal for beginners.
- Gather several fuzzy sticks of your chosen color.
- Cut the sticks into equal lengths.
- Arrange five sticks in a star shape, overlapping the ends.
- Twist the ends together securely to form the star.
- Optional: Add glitter or glue on decorative elements.
Fuzzy Stick Christmas Trees
Craft festive trees in about 15-20 minutes. Great for the holiday season.
- Use green fuzzy sticks for the tree.
- Cut several sticks into varying lengths, creating a tree shape.
- Glue or twist the sticks together, forming a triangular shape.
- Add a small star or other decorative element to the top.
- Optional: Use smaller colored fuzzy sticks for ornaments.

Secure Joints:
Ensure that joints are tightly twisted or glued to prevent the structure from falling apart. Overlapping the ends before twisting provides extra security. Using a small amount of glue on the overlapping section will add further reinforcement. Ensure all joints are firmly connected to maintain the integrity of the design.

Q3: Can I wash fuzzy sticks after crafting?
Fuzzy sticks are not typically washable in the traditional sense. While you can wipe them down with a damp cloth to remove excess dirt or glue, submerging them in water can cause them to lose their shape or become discolored. Spot cleaning is generally recommended to maintain their appearance and integrity.
Q4: What type of glue works best with fuzzy sticks?
Most craft glues will work effectively with fuzzy sticks. Hot glue provides a very strong, fast bond, but care should be taken to avoid burns. White glue or school glue is also a good option, providing a strong bond once dried and being easier for children to use. Consider the projects needs and your own comfort level when selecting glue.
Q5: How can I store fuzzy sticks?
Store fuzzy sticks in a cool, dry place to prevent them from becoming brittle or discolored. Keeping them in a sealed container or bag helps to maintain their flexibility and protects them from dust or damage. Organize them by color to make future projects easier to plan. Proper storage can significantly increase their longevity.
